I will say that a tooth might not always come right away. Keira had been like this on and off since 3 months and finally a few weeks ago (have to look where I have it written down) she cut the bottom front two back to back. With Khloe she too began signs of teething at 3 months and did not actually cut a tooth until one day shy of 10 or 11 months (again I would have to look to check the time) so she might have several spurts of tiredness then all of sudden go back to her every day norm.
